There is disclosed a process for cleaning a harmful gas which comprises bringing a harmful gaseous halogenide such as chlorine, hydrogen chloride, dichlorosilane, silicon tetrachloride, phosphorus trichloride, chlorine trifluoride, boron trichloride, boron trifluoride, tungsten hexafluoride, silicon tetrafluoride, fluorine, hydrogen fluoride and hydrogen bromide into contact with a cleaning agent comprising zinc oxide, aluminum oxide and an alkali compound to remove the above halogenide. The above process is extremely effective for promptly and efficiently removing the above gaseous halogenide that is contained in the gas discharged from semiconductor manufacturing process or leaked suddenly from a gas bomb in an emergency.

A process for cleaning a harmful gas which comprises a step of: contacting a harmful gas containing a gaseous halogenide as a harmful component with a cleaning agent comprising (i) zinc oxide, (ii) aluminum oxide and (iii) at least one compound selected from the group consisting of potassium carbonate, potassium hydrogencarbonate, potassium hydroxide, sodium carbonate, sodium hydrogencarbonate, sodium hydroxide and ammonium hydroxide, to remove said harmful gas; the gaseous halogenide being at least one member selected from the group consisting of chlorine, hydrogen chloride, dichlorosilane, silicon tetrachloride, phosphorus trichloride, chlorine trifluoride, boron trichloride, boron trifluoride, tungsten hexafluoride, silicon tetrafluoride, fluorine, hydrogen fluoride and hydrogen bromide; a ratio of the aluminum oxide to the zinc oxide being 0.05 to 0.60 expressed in terms of a number of aluminum atoms per one zinc atom and a ratio of the compound (iii) to the zinc oxide being 0.05 to 0.50 expressed in terms of a number of potassium atoms, or sodium atoms or ammonium groups per one zinc oxide; the gaseous halogenide having a concentration of 50 to 1,000 ppm by volume; and the aluminum oxide being hydrated alumina.
